From 000ec1e8f616586358149b1da14a36f63f6dc604 Mon Sep 17 00:00:00 2001
From: liushijie <lslola@126.com>
Date: 星期三, 19 三月 2025 10:10:59 +0800
Subject: [PATCH] 增加渠道佣金
---
LifePayment/LifePayment.Application.Contracts/LifePay/ILifePayService.cs | 33 +++++++++++++++++++++++++++++++++
1 files changed, 33 insertions(+), 0 deletions(-)
diff --git a/LifePayment/LifePayment.Application.Contracts/LifePay/ILifePayService.cs b/LifePayment/LifePayment.Application.Contracts/LifePay/ILifePayService.cs
index 93d2726..70adeed 100644
--- a/LifePayment/LifePayment.Application.Contracts/LifePay/ILifePayService.cs
+++ b/LifePayment/LifePayment.Application.Contracts/LifePay/ILifePayService.cs
@@ -113,13 +113,44 @@
Task SetLifePayChannelsStatus(Guid id, LifePayChannelsStatsEnum status);
+ /// <summary>
+ /// 缂栬緫鎶樻墸
+ /// </summary>
+ /// <param name="input"></param>
+ /// <returns></returns>
Task CreateEditLifePayRate(List<LifePayRateInput> input);
+
+ /// <summary>
+ /// 缂栬緫鎵嬬画璐硅垂鐜�
+ /// </summary>
+ /// <param name="input"></param>
+ /// <returns></returns>
+ Task CreateEditLifePayPremium(List<LifePayPremiumInput> input);
+
+ /// <summary>
+ /// 椤荤煡閰嶇疆
+ /// </summary>
+ /// <param name="input"></param>
+ /// <returns></returns>
+ Task EditIntroInfo(LifePayIntroInfoInput input);
/// <summary>
/// 鑾峰彇鎶樻墸
/// </summary>
/// <returns></returns>
Task<List<LifePayRateListOutput>> GetRate();
+
+ /// <summary>
+ /// 鑾峰彇鎵嬬画璐硅垂鐜�
+ /// </summary>
+ /// <returns></returns>
+ Task<List<LifePayPremiumListOutput>> GetPremium();
+
+ /// <summary>
+ /// 鑾峰彇椤荤煡
+ /// </summary>
+ /// <returns></returns>
+ Task<List<LifePayIntroInfoOutput>> GetIntroInfo(LifePayOrderTypeEnum type);
/// <summary>
/// 鑾峰彇鎴戠殑璁㈠崟鍒嗛〉鏁版嵁
@@ -171,6 +202,8 @@
/// <returns></returns>
Task<PageOutput<CreateEditPayChannelsInput>> GetLifePayChannlesPage(PageInput input);
+ Task<List<CreateEditPayChannelsInput>> GetLifePayChannlesAllList();
+
Task<CreateEditPayChannelsInput> GetLifePayChannlesDto(Guid id);
--
Gitblit v1.9.1